
James Swanton
Biography
James Swanton is best known for otherworldly characters. He fathered the Antichrist as both Satan in Apartment 7A (2024) and the Jackal in The First Omen (2024), as well as appearing as the Magician in Tarot (2024), the Ash Man in Stopmotion (2023), the Spirit in Host (2020) and the Creature in Frankenstein's Creature (2018). He also played the title roles in two BBC chillers: Lot No. 249 (2023), Mark Gatiss's Ghost Story for Christmas, and The Curse of the Ninth (2024) in the final series of Inside No. 9 (2014). As a stage actor, James has been closely associated with Dickens. He took his acclaimed one-man play "Sikes & Nancy" to the West End's Trafalgar Studios and annually performs "A Christmas Carol" (amongst other ghost stories) at London's Charles Dickens Museum.
